Just how much does it cost to redecorate hardwood with a pro?

Like everything else in the home remodeling globe, hardwood refinishing expenses rely on your location, your kind of floor, its current problem, and also (naturally) its square video footage. Right here are some ballpark estimates if you employ a pro to redecorate flooring:

  • To entirely redecorate a hardwood floor-- including sanding down the leading layer to bare wood, then using a number of layers of new coating like polyurethane-- expect to pay flooring experts .50 to per square foot, or 0 to 0 for a 15-by-15-foot room.
  • If your floor is slightly worn but or else in good problem, you can manage on just recoating the flooring without sanding. This will typically cost per square foot, or 5.
  • For a custom-made refinish work involving sanding the hardwood flooring, and using spots, water-based or oil-based coatings, as well as other finishes like those that are acid-cured, anticipate to pay .75 to per square foot, or 0 to ,125.

The cost of labor for tarnishing and fining sand is the major variable when figuring the typical cost of wood floor refinishing, since the cost of experienced labor differs throughout by ZIP code. For example, HomeWyse states hardwood floor refinishing in a 15-by-15-foot room expenses 1.92 to 9.42 in snazzy Scarsdale, NY, however 3.45 to 8.02 in Mobile, AL. Exactly how much does it cost to refinish wood flooring on your own?

You'll have to rent out a commercial drum sander for about a day if you desire to redecorate flooring yourself as a Do It Yourself job. To deal with sanded hardwood flooring, you will certainly likewise have to get sealers as well as stains to refinish, which will usually cost in between 5 as well as 5, according to CostHelper. The complete cost relies on the number of square feet of hardwood flooring you're tackling.

While the DIY variation seems alluring, know that refinishing hardwood floors is not as very easy as it might look. (And also allow's obtain real: Does fining sand a hardwood floor with every one of those hard-to-reach corners and also walls also look all that easy?) Refinishing hardwood floors can be a dusty, time-consuming work, despite equipments that record the majority of the mess. (You'll undergo a great deal of sandpaper.).

Additionally remember that prior to you begin refinishing wood flooring, you need to eliminate every little thing on the floor-- furniture, carpets, piano, wall systems-- which can be difficult, backbreaking job. Then, you have to cover every little thing in your house during a refinish to avoid it from obtaining split in sawdust throughout the sanding stage, which will certainly happen also if you evaluate off the refinishing location.

What to look for in a professional.

Like anything else, you obtain what you pay for when working with a hardwood refinishing professional. Whereas anybody that can rev up a sander can get rid of the leading layers of a floor, only a knowledgeable refinisher can manage the fining sand process to develop a smooth, even surface. As well as applying discolor without drips and also lines between brushstrokes takes skill.

The Hardwood Manufacturers Association recommends house owners to hire a certified wood refinisher to ensure the floor refinish face-lift is done suitably, claims Linda Jovanovich, executive vice president of the organization. These specialists are checked as well as certified by the National Wood Flooring Association.

When employing a professional as well as evaluating the cost to refinish hardwood floors, ask the following questions while obtaining a complimentary quote:

  • How many years of experience do you have, and also can you supply a minimum of 3 referrals?
  • Does the estimated rate for the refinish include moving heavy furniture and also home appliances, or will I have to pay added to work with movers?
  • That is accountable for cleanup after the refinish? If the refinisher likewise cleans, what will the clean-up entail?
  • What guarantee does the refinisher deal? Are complimentary recoats available?
  • Exactly how much down payment does the refinish call for, and also what are the conditions of further repayments?

How to plan for refinishing hardwood floors.

Hardwood floors refinishing is a hurry-up-and-wait procedure. In between each layer of discolor or sealer, you should wait numerous hrs before you can stroll on the floorings, possibly 24 hrs if you live in high-humidity areas. That lag time might put your kitchen or bedroom out of payment for days throughout a refinish.

And although discolorations as well as sealers do not send out all the VOCs they once did-- you can buy low- or no-VOC floor products for your refinish. And if you're specifically nose-sensitive to, claim, polyurethane, the scent might send you running to the local Motel 6. So you may intend to add that to the cost of refinishing hardwood floors.

Is Hardwood Floor Refinishing Needed?

To examine the problem of your hardwood floors, start with traffic locations that obtain the most wear in your house and execute the complying with examinations.

Water Examination

Pour a spoonful of water onto the floor. If it creates beads that remain on the surface of the wood, the floor surface is still great. The finish is worn and also requires to be recovered if the water is gradually taken in into the wood. If the water is quickly absorbed into the wood as well as leaves a darker stain externally, there's no finish left; the wood requires refinishing as quickly as possible.

Clean any staying water from the floor with a paper towel, as well as repeat the examination on any type of other locations that look as though they might require refinishing. You may be able to get away with refinishing just the most awful areas.

Calling Card Test

Locate a location where there's a minor space between floorboards. Stick a calling card or similar paper stock all the way right into the split. Make a mark with pencil along the floor edge. Get rid of the card and also action from the edge of the card to the line. If it's much less than 3/4 inch, the floor is put on or the mounted wood is too slim. You could desire a specialist to do fining sand, particularly if there are deep scrapes or dings in the floor. If there is non-sandable deposit, such as old carpet or tile adhesive on the floor, you can make use of scrapes to remove it.

Look for warped boards, low areas, awful gaps, poor spots or squeaky places indicating loosened boards. You may need to get a contractor to change some wood for the floor to look great again.

Can You Refinish Wood Floors One Room Each Time?

No, you can not redecorate hardwood floors one room at once if the floorboards proceed into an additional room. You have to sand the whole location to ensure that you can remove the floorboards evenly. You'll need to use your covering as well as inish to the floor without missing out on spots.

If you determine to deal with one room at a time, your floorings will have an unequal finish, which will certainly make them look different. You desire the aesthetic appeals of your wooden flooring to be consistent throughout your home, so it is ideal to refinish your entire floor at the same time.

On the other hand, If you wish to function on one room at a time, you'll have to mount a shift item that divides all the rooms. Furthermore, you'll have the ability to redecorate one room each time if each location has a various kind of hardwood flooring.

Can You Pick A Different Color Discoloration When Refinishing Hardwood Floors?

Yes, you can select a different color stain for your hardwood floors. When you sand your floorings down, you're generally getting rid of old stains and also surfaces. Once sanded, your floor will certainly have its all-natural wooden surface area exposed. By doing this you can choose any kind of discolor shade you want for the project.

Make sure the stain you choose matches the appearances of the room and your interior design. Stay clear of low-grade wood tarnish because it can adversely influence the resilience of the wood. Low-grade wood stains may also cause mold development and also might discolor in time.

There are high-quality wood discolorations on the marketplace that will certainly add a slim layer of protection to the surface area of your floorings. A top quality tarnish will safeguard wooden floorings from surface messing and also UV degradation.

You can expect to pay for a gallon of premium wood tarnish for your floors, which is more affordable than buying brand new hardwood floorboards.

What Is A Hardwood Floor Display And Also Recoat?

A display and recoat is when you provide your hardwood floors an added sheen. Screening means to buff your floorings before using your covering, which will safeguard the surface of your floors.

Screening is performed with an industrial floor barrier to smooth out the surface of the wood with an abrasive pad. Buffing allows the layer to comply with the wood surface area better. The display and also recoat procedure recovers the glow of the wood for a new and enhanced look.
